About the Role:

The Part-Time, Certified Medical Assistant/Receptionist at Brooklyn Gastroenterology at 2952 Brighton 3rd Street, Suite 205, Brooklyn, NY plays a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of our healthcare services. This position is responsible for providing exceptional patient care while managing administrative tasks that support the clinical team. The ideal candidate will facilitate patient interactions, assist with medical procedures, and maintain accurate patient records. By effectively coordinating between patients and healthcare providers, this role directly contributes to the overall patient experience and satisfaction. Ultimately, the Medical Assistant/Receptionist will help foster a welcoming environment that prioritizes patient health and well-being.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Certification as a Medical Assistant (CMA), Registered Medical Assistant (RMA), or Certified Phlebotomy Technician (CPT).
  • Experience in a gastroenterology or similar healthcare/office setting.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Knowledge of electronic health record (EHR) systems.
  • Experience with EKG and blood draws.
  • Basic knowledge or HIPPA regulations.
  • Familiarity with insurances, copays, and eligibility verification.
  • Bilingual abilities to assist a diverse patient population - Russian a plus.

Responsibilities:

  • Greet and check in patients, ensuring a positive first impression and efficient registration process.
  • Assist healthcare providers during examinations and procedures, including preparing instruments and maintaining a sterile environment.
  • Manage patient records, including updating information and ensuring compliance with privacy regulations.
  • Schedule appointments, follow up on patient inquiries, and handle billing and insurance verification.
  • Provide education to patients regarding procedures, medications, and follow-up care as directed by healthcare providers.
  • Answer multiple phone lines and assist with front desk tasks as needed.
  • Multitask effectively in a busy office setting.
  • Check insurance eligibility and benefits for services.
  • Submit and follow up on prior authorizations for medications or procedures.
